Tech advancements and economic incentives are fueling electric vehicle growth. Falling battery costs, improved driving ranges, and expanding federal tax credits have made EVs increasingly accessible. Meanwhile, cities are investing in public charging infrastructure—from highways to urban hubs—reducing range anxiety. As major automakers commit to electrification, more affordable and practical options are entering the market, driving mainstream demand.

Federal and state incentives remain available, including up to $7,500 in tax credits and local rebates. Eligibility may depend on vehicle type, income, and assembly location—staying updated ensures maximum benefit.
